Omninet Group was founded in 1985 when our principals were responsible for the management, strategic development, operations and financing of Omninet Communications Services. In its effort to develop a breakthrough technology, Omninet worked with a newly formed research and development company in San Diego to develop a revolutionary satellite communications system for the trucking industry. Omninet recognized that the engineers working on the project were on the cutting edge of research and development in the wireless space and the two groups merged in the quest to expand the boundaries of wireless communications. This point of convergence jumpstarted Qualcomm’s journey toward becoming a leader in the wireless industry.

Based on the satellite communications technology, Qualcomm developed and commercialized the proprietary Code Division Multiple Access (CDMA) technology, which has become a standard for mobile communications. This development laid the foundation for Qualcomm to emerge as the worldwide leader in the wireless communications industry. Today, Qualcomm (NASDAQ: QCOM) is an S&P 500 company with a multi-billion dollar market capitalization.
